中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

Mybatis中@Param與多參數使用

小樊
85
2024-07-12 10:42:35
欄目: 編程語言

在MyBatis中,通常使用@Param注解來給SQL語句中的參數起別名,以便在Mapper接口方法中引用這些參數。

當需要傳遞多個參數給SQL語句時,可以使用@Param注解為每個參數起一個別名,并在Mapper接口方法中使用這些別名來引用不同的參數。

例如,假設有一個Mapper接口方法需要傳遞兩個參數給SQL語句:

@Select("SELECT * FROM user WHERE username = #{name} AND age = #{age}")
User getUserByNameAndAge(@Param("name") String username, @Param("age") int age);

在這個例子中,我們使用@Param注解為兩個參數起了別名"name"和"age",并在SQL語句中分別引用這兩個別名,從而傳遞兩個參數給SQL語句。

需要注意的是,如果Mapper接口方法只接收一個參數,可以不使用@Param注解,直接在SQL語句中引用參數即可。只有在傳遞多個參數時才需要使用@Param注解。

0
新安县| 韩城市| 吉水县| 诏安县| 洪洞县| 美姑县| 响水县| 柳州市| 兴和县| 远安县| 延川县| 武威市| 广平县| 赤峰市| 河北区| 土默特右旗| 新闻| 茌平县| 古蔺县| 泸州市| 灵山县| 扶沟县| 尚志市| 彩票| 浏阳市| 汝州市| 西青区| 稻城县| 姜堰市| 赤水市| 新巴尔虎右旗| 长治县| 凯里市| 关岭| 桂林市| 三都| 蒙山县| 炉霍县| 尖扎县| 兴安盟| 东丰县|